1. 全部视频列表UC表的设计
全部视频列表UC表是一个用于存储所有视频信息的数据库表,它包含了视频的标题、时长、上传日期等字段。设计一个高效的UC表结构是非常重要的,可以支持快速的视频搜索和排序功能。
在设计UC表时,需要考虑以下几个方面:
一个好的UC表设计不仅能提高查询性能,还能简化业务逻辑,提高系统的可维护性。
2. UC表数据的导入和导出
使用JSON格式存储UC表的数据可以方便进行数据的导入和导出操作。通过使用合适的数据导入导出工具,可以将视频数据从其他系统导入到UC表中,也可以将UC表中的数据导出到其他系统中进行分析和处理。
3. 全部视频的分类管理
通过使用UC表,可以实现对全部视频的分类管理。可以按照视频类型、上传者等进行筛选,方便用户快速找到感兴趣的视频。这对于用户来说是非常友好的,也能提高用户的体验。
4. 全文搜索技术的应用
利用全文搜索技术,可以实现对UC表中视频标题、描述等内容进行全文检索。这样可以提高搜索结果的准确性和速度,让用户更方便地找到自己想要的视频。
5. UC表的性能优化
为了提高UC表的查询和插入操作的效率,可以采取一些性能优化措施。比如使用索引来加速查询,使用分区技术来分散数据存储和查询的压力等。
6. 数据分析和业务决策
利用UC表的数据,可以进行数据分析和业务决策。比如统计每个上传者的视频数量、观看次数等,从而了解用户的兴趣爱好,为后续的业务发展提供参考依据。
7. 视频播放历史记录功能
使用UC表可以实现视频播放历史记录功能,记录用户观看过的视频。这样用户可以方便地查看自己的播放历史,并且可以根据历史记录推荐相关的视频,提升用户的粘性和用户体验。
8. 用户友好的接口设计
设计一个用户友好的UC表接口,可以方便开发者使用和维护。接口应该具备良好的可用性和可扩展性,提供丰富的查询和操作功能,同时保证接口的稳定性和安全性。
综上所述,全部视频列表UC表的设计与优化是一个复杂而重要的工作。通过合理的表结构设计、数据导入导出、分类管理、全文搜索、性能优化、数据分析和接口设计,可以提高系统的效率和用户体验,为用户提供更好的视频观看和管理服务。